NORFOLK, Va. -- Ray Lawry rushed for 194 yards and three touchdowns and Old Dominion defeated Florida International 42-28 on Saturday.With the Monarchs victory, Old Dominion (9-3, 7-1) tied Western Kentucky atop the Conference USAs East Division. However, Western Kentucky, which defeated the Monarchs last month and beat Marshall 60-6 Saturday night, will face West champ Louisiana Tech in the conference title game on Dec. 3. The Monarchs have won five straight games.Lawry ran for touchdowns of 22, 2 and 24 yards and David Washington threw to Zach Pascal and Travis Fulgham for scores. The Monarchs rolled up 521 total yards.Isaiah Browns 45-yard interception return gave the Panthers (4-8, 4-4) a 21-14 lead early in the third quarter. Old Dominion responded with 28 straight points, 14 in each of the final two quarters.FIU interim head coach Ron Cooper finished 4-4 after taking over for Ron Turner, who was fired Sept. 25. Ovechkin and his Russian national team were eliminated from the mens hockey tournament in Sochi on Wednesday with a 3-1 quarter-final loss to Finland.Hull KR have sacked head coach Chris Chester, with his assistant Willie Poching taking charge for Fridays Super League clash at home to St Helens, live on Sky Sports. The club issued a statement on Wednesday morning that Chester had stood down with immediate effect.The statement added: The sole focus of everybody at the club at this time is on Fridays game and securing two much needed points and any further comment on the situation, future plans and expectations will follow after the weekend. Rovers fans reacted angrily at the end of the 14-12 home defeat to Wakefield Wildcats on Sunday, booing the players after a result which left them without a win after the first three Super League rounds.The loss to visitors Wakefield at the KC Lightstream Stadium was the first win of the season for last years bottom club.Hosts Rovers are ninth in the table, with just a solitary point from the opening round 16-16 draw at home with Castleford Tigers.Chester, who previously played for the Robins as a back row forward, became a coach at the club in 2009, before being promoted to head coach in 2014.In his first full season at the helm, the 37-year-old guided Rovers to the 2015 Challenge Cup final, which they lost 50-0 to holders Leeds Rhinos. Poching, 42, joined Rovers as assistant coach from Warrington at the start of last season, and said he is now ready to take control of a team.Im really excited, Poching said. Ive been 10 years as an assistant and Im not a head coach yet - Im just holding the fort. Its not the way I would have envisaged or liked but Ive got a job to do.Im genuinely excited to work with the players we have here. I love coming to work every day.Asked if he would like the job on a permanent basis, Poching said: Definitely. Ive waited almost 10 years for a chance to come along. Ive bided my time, Ive done an apprenticeship.
